  7. One more Crimebuster related Kickstarter coming up, but this one in particular I really wanted to share with you all. That's because I'm super honored to be able to present a never before published cover by the legendary George Tuska. Tuska, of course, made his name at Lev Gleason and worked on some of Crimebuster's original stories in Boy Comics, so being able to present a new Crimebuster cover featuring his art is really humbling for me. It will be the cover for the Crimebuster 80th Anniversary Special, which is a 100-page giant in the DC tradition, featuring selected Golden Age reprints, as well as a colorized and remastered edition of my Crimebuster story from Crimebusters #1 (aka Boy Comics #120). Here's the cover: Fans of the series will recognize, as I did, that this image is based off the classic cover from Boy Comics #6 - note the same tree, house, and outfit on Iron Jaw. The full pencils for this were commissioned by a friend of mine who, along with the Tuska family, has given his go ahead to publish this. I then had the full pencils inked by DC and Archie artist Andrew Pepoy, and had it colored as well by colorist Shayne Cui. This is one project I'm probably going to lose money on, but it's totally worth it to be able to get this cover out there - and to get one in my own collection!   11. Marvel Spotlight #5 7.0 - $3000 Payment for this is by check only, no Paypal. This is a beautiful, super tight copy. Defects to take note of: the main one is the tiny tear upper right corner which led to a small crease running up to top edge from it. There's also a very slight color breaking finger bend on the right edge by the trademark TM, and another on the bottom edge between the OF and ALL. One small, faint spine tick at top of top staple. Back cover has very slight browning (foxing?) along bottom left edge/corner and a little at top left corner. This comic is glossy, the colors are fantastic, and it is as tight and flat as a drum head. I'd swear it had never been opened, except I know I read it once when I bought it 30 years ago. It looks and feels like it just came off the stand. I ran this by the grading forum a while back and the consensus based on the technical flaws was 7.0, so I'm going with that. It's from Fox, and has their usual salacious content - a woman gets taken in by a con man who kidnaps her before cops seize him at gunpoint; another married woman gets involved with an old flame, leading to a fist fight on the front lawn; and a jealous nurse bullies a pregnant woman into attempting suicide. This is a Canadian edition, but it's a bit odd. It's in full color unlike other Canadian editions I have seen; it also contains all the stories on the cover, which is the same as the US edition. I have the sense that this might not be missing any content like many Canadian editions are. However, I'm not sure, because this appears to be on the rare side - it's the only issue of the series that hasn't been indexed by the GCD so I can't compare interiors.
